No Labels Gives Problem-Solvers Seal to Nick Lampson

No Labels Commends Congressional Candidate’s Commitment to Problem Solving

This week No Labels gave the Problem-Solvers Seal of Approval to Nick Lampson of Texas’ 14th Congressional District. The Problem-Solvers Seal is awarded to candidates or legislators who agree to join No Labels’ emerging “Problem-Solvers Bloc,” a group of lawmakers who are dedicated to working across the aisle to discuss effective, principled and pragmatic solutions to our country’s problems. Lampson has committed to join the bloc when elected.
